Ticket #—: Pop-up office, Selwick Trade Fair, Hall 4. Our Lanternworks stand goes live Thursday, and the back-of-stand office cabin is now wired up — Wi-Fi, printer, kettle, the works. Cabin door has a keypad lock since kit will be stored overnight. Cleaning crew comes through at 7am, so first person in should tidy cables off the floor. Anyone from the desk covering the stand will need the code below.

badge for fafop-fajof: bdg-Z-47

Rounding drift in Lentara's conversion service stems from intermediate truncation to four decimal places before the final rate multiply. Mitigation: the reconciliation job recomputes totals nightly with full-precision decimals and writes deltas exceeding half a minor unit to the audit ledger. Reviewers should confirm the job reads rates only from the signed rates table. To inspect the ledger directly, connect with the string below.

primary connection of yagep-kahip = redis://giliel_svc:zYiKsLL2PLpfPL@db-348f.xolmarsys.corp:5432/fenwyn

## Limits & Quotas: Driftkit SDK Parity

Quick reference for support folks fielding "why does the Kotlin SDK behave differently?" tickets. Short answer: both Driftkit clients share the same server quotas, but the retry ceilings and batch sizes were tuned separately and only converged in the latest release. If a customer is on an older Kotlin build, mismatches are expected. The shared limits both SDKs now enforce are these.

tuning table, kajog-bawip:
TIERS = {
    "kelius": 256,
    "lammir": 543,
}

**Mgmt Meeting Minutes — Retiring the Brightline Range**

Quick recap for sales leads at Fenholt Supplies: we agreed to retire the Brightline fixture range by year-end. Remaining stock moves to clearance pricing next month, and accounts on standing orders get migrated to the Lumetta range. Trade-in incentives were approved in principle. The confidential note on next steps sits just below.

board note of bajof-bajeg: The pricing group signed off on a budget of $13.4 million for Project Sildor. The renewal with Lamixek Holdings closes at $48.9 million a year, 49 percent above the last contract.